In the design of new drug delivery systems, carbon nanotubes (CNTs) have received increasing attention as promising nanocarriers, particularly, for the possibility to be easily conjugated with multiple bioactive molecules. In this way, this chapter describes the diverse properties and strategies of modification employed for CNTs in order to improve their use in drug delivery, focusing on their application as drug delivery systems for diverse therapies such as antimicrobials, anti-inflammatories, antioxidants, and anti-hypertensive. Finally, we covered the most recent studies of the toxicity of CNTs and the future aspects for improving the biocompatibility of these promising materials. © 2023 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
